Bartolo Colon Notches A Special Victory

With the Mets 6-5 win in Friday night’s contest with the Cleveland Indians, RHP Bartolo Colon notched his 219th career victory. He moves up the career wins list and is now tied for 77th all-time. Another achievement took place with win number 219 however, as Colon tied fellow Dominican native, former Met, and Hall of Famer Pedro Martinez for second all-time in wins by a Dominican-born...

Mets Rally Late, But Fall To Indians 7-5

The Mets (4-6) were defeated by the Cleveland Indians (5-4) this afternoon at Progressive Field by a score of 7-5. Pitching: Matt Harvey got off to a stellar start, striking out the side in the first, and carrying a perfect game into the fifth inning. However, the wheels fell off for Harvey after his strong start, as he was chased from the game in the sixth inning after allowing five runs on six...
